When shopping for the ideal pushchair, there are many things to take into consideration. What you like about your outdoor life might not be appropriate for city living. A pushchair that glides across shiny floors could be unable to handle muddy terrain.
If you are planning to have an additional child, a travel system which can be transformed into a twin pushchair would be a great idea. These are designed to grow along with your baby and can be used from birth to six months.
iCandy Peach
This is a favourite of famous moms, and it offers a lot of features at a low price. The spacious carrycot makes it ideal for babies from birth. Innovative adaptors allow you to convert it into a twin pushchair. Its modern premium knitted jersey fabrics are sturdy and soft with a luxurious feel. A large canopy and a multi-position reclining seat offer baby maximum comfort, while a convenient zip pocket is a great place to store essentials. Elevators raise the seat unit, creating a highchair on-the-go that allows parents to Roll Up and Dine at restaurants. It comes with a chic changing bag and footmuff to create a complete travel system.
The Peach 7's aluminum chassis is lighter than the majority of pushchairs. Its puncture-proof polyurethane tyres have been designed to handle any terrain from bumpy roads and sports fields to parkland and forest paths that are muddy. The suspension has been made softer to ensure comfort for the baby and the parent facing pushchair. The front wheels can be turned to allow you to turn corners even with one hand. Its compact footprint and tight turning circle means that it is able to easily navigate narrow hallways and shop aisles, so it is ideal for city life.
This version is available in a range of colours, including iCandy Black Special Edition with black fabrics and a black chassis for a monochrome look. It comes with a built-in cup holder and is compatible with the iCandy Cuddler, iCandy Rocker and the iCandy Sidekick Stroller. It is available directly from iCandy for a price of PS1,149, or from third-party retailers like Babythingz.
Babyzen YOYO2
The Babyzen YOYO2 pram is a lightweight, stylish and easy-to-use pram. It's a great choice for those who reside in a city and frequently use the tube, would like to fold up your stroller and place it into your trunk while driving, or want a light pram for days out with just you and baby. It is also environmentally friendly.
The YOYO 2 which is priced at PS399 it includes the chassis and the 6+ color pack. Add the newborn bassinet (sold separately) and you'll be spending around PS800 for all-inclusive travel setup. It's similar to other pushchairs that are 'urban like the Bugaboo Bee 6
YOYO 2 folds down to 52 44x18 or 20 173 x 7.1 in. It is compatible with the baggage allowances for cabins established by most airlines. It is also among the few double strollers that can be used from birth, using either the bassinet for newborns and/or the 0+ or newborn fabric pack.
It has small wheels which are ideal for grass and pavements but it is able to take on bumpier terrain. However, adventurous families might want to consider something with all-terrain tires. It has a neat trick also: the handlebar can be pulled back so that you can take a seat in a restaurant after you've rolled your YOYO 2.
The YOYO 2 is simple to move around, and has one of the lowest turning ratios in stroller pushchair land. It requires two people to fold it and unfold. It isn't able to be pulled by its wheels when folded like some other umbrella pushchairs.

Bugaboo Bee
The Bugaboo Bee is a stylish functional, comfortable, and affordable pushchair. It's been around since 2007 and was recently updated with the new Bee 6 model. The most notable difference over the previous models is that it now has a height adjustable backrest as well as a bigger sun canopy and a circular joint system making it easier to move the seat and turn it towards you or away from you.
The Bee 6 is also a lot narrower, which makes it great for squeezing on to public transport or for navigating the city's thorny streets. In addition, its iconic yellow colouring makes it easy for pedestrians to spot you on the street and for Deliveroo cyclists to see you when they're rushing down your street.
It's also enjoyable to drive, with a responsive steering. The suspension is smooth and nice. I also loved the large and deep basket, which is perfect for supermarket trips, and the fact that it's easily accessible whether you have the seat forward facing pushchair the other direction or away from it.
The Bee's solidity and durability is another thing that impressed me. The handle bar is easy to hold and the design of the pushchair oozes quality. It's easy to tell that this is a buggy that's been designed to last generation after generation.
Of course all of this isn't cheap. The Bee costs PS1000 at retail price but it's also much less than other strollers of the highest quality. It's well worth the cost, considering its features and construction. Particularly for those who value style as well as functionality.
